Output 50e7673972acb695a8e7d2a6e5bfa01c5495ec3047818cb3e1a2abaafdfd8bb1:0

value
4597620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53d07a8464996da2daf6aca59b2f928c20233044 OP_EQUAL
address
39LBkp2JAuhT8UVxKTgZ8KtwiczA4JTNU9
transaction
50e7673972acb695a8e7d2a6e5bfa01c5495ec3047818cb3e1a2abaafdfd8bb1
spent
true